Abstract
Particles diffusing in -dimensional space among a random distribution of stationary spherical traps are considered. Given a particle at the origin at time , it is shown that the density of particles at the origin as must decay at least as fast as . The density here is obtained by averaging the diffusive field for a given configuration of traps over all configurations. The present upper bound coincides with the lower bound recently derived by Grassberger and Procaccia.
